Can you bring water bottle to Husker game?

Published in Stadium Hydration Policy 2 mins read

Yes, you can bring an empty personal water bottle to a Husker game. This policy is in place to ensure fans can stay hydrated throughout the event.

Water Bottle Policy at Memorial Stadium

To ensure fan comfort and safety, Memorial Stadium has specific guidelines regarding items brought into the venue. Regarding water bottles, the policy is designed to help attendees stay hydrated while adhering to security protocols.

Item Category Status Details
Personal Empty Water Bottle Permitted Must be empty upon entry. Intended for refilling at stadium water fountains located throughout the venue.
Filled Water Bottle Not Permitted For security and policy reasons, pre-filled bottles (whether with water or other liquids) are not allowed.

This policy allows fans convenient access to free water, aligning with the stadium's encouragement for attendees to drink plenty of water both before and during the game.

Practical Tips for Game Day Hydration

Staying hydrated is crucial for enjoying a long game, especially during warm weather. Here are some practical tips:

  • Pre-Game Hydration: Start drinking water hours before you even arrive at Memorial Stadium.
  • Pack an Empty Bottle: Bring a reusable water bottle that is completely empty to expedite your entry process.
  • Locate Water Fountains: Upon entering, take note of where water fountains are situated so you can easily refill your bottle.
  • Regular Sips: Don't wait until you feel thirsty. Take consistent sips from your refilled bottle throughout the game to maintain hydration.

By following these simple guidelines, you can comfortably enjoy the vibrant atmosphere of a Husker game while staying well-hydrated.
